Jack Barham fired Aldershot’s second-half equaliser as they held promotion-chasers Gateshead to a 2-2 draw at the International Stadium.
Gateshead defender Robbie Tinkler rattled the crossbar with a 35-yard effort before Aldershot took an 11th-minute lead through Josh Barrett, who converted Barham’s cross.
The home side hit back eight minutes later when Owen Oseni headed an equaliser at the far post and Callum Whelan turned home a rebound, after Jacob Butterfield’s shot had been saved, to put Gateshead 2-1 up.
Both sides continued to create chances in the second half and Shots drew level in the 58th minute when Barham smashed home a rebound after James Henry’s initial effort had been saved.
